Output ca557810681edb0cdce4a962e487f8134b19f94af2e7088df82a5ded73b7c7c6:1

value
8591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bffeafcac6582163757251de0ac9fc8dc7cfa62e OP_EQUAL
address
3KCC68BdYpUPgUSDREvcvM1jNLrLGx4D42
transaction
ca557810681edb0cdce4a962e487f8134b19f94af2e7088df82a5ded73b7c7c6
spent
true